Vegan Pumpkin Pie

Delicious Vegan Pumpkin Pie with Creamy, Dreamy Filling

Enjoy this Vegan Pumpkin Pie, a delightful dessert that combines simplicity and rich flavors, perfect for Thanksgiving gatherings.
Prep Time 20 minutes
Cook Time 1 hour 10 minutes
Chilling Time 4 hours
Total Time 5 hours 30 minutes
Servings: 8 slices
Course: Dessert
Cuisine: American, Vegan
Calories: 280

Ingredients
  

For the Pie Crust
  • 1 crust Vegan Pie Crust Can be homemade or store-bought
For the Filling
  • 1 can Canned Pumpkin Puree
  • 1 cup Coconut Cream Can substitute with silken tofu or cashew cream
  • 3/4 cup Brown Sugar Can substitute with coconut sugar
  • 1/4 cup Cornstarch Can substitute with arrowroot
  • 2 teaspoons Pumpkin Pie Spice Can use individual spices if needed
  • 1 teaspoon Vanilla Extract Pure vanilla preferred
  • 1/2 teaspoon Sea Salt

Equipment

  • 9-inch Pie Pan
  • blender
  • Plastic Wrap

Method
 

Step-by-Step Instructions
  1. Prepare the Vegan Pie Crust: Combine your ingredients to form a dough, wrap in plastic wrap, and chill in the refrigerator for at least 2 hours.
  2. Preheat Oven: Set your oven to 350°F (175°C) and position a rack in the lower third.
  3. Blend the Filling: In a blender, combine the canned pumpkin puree, coconut cream, brown sugar, cornstarch, pumpkin pie spice, vanilla extract, and sea salt, blending until smooth.
  4. Fill Pie Crust: Pour the filling into the chilled pie crust and smooth the top with a spatula.
  5. Bake Pie: Place the pie on a baking sheet and bake for 55-70 minutes until the crust is golden and filling is set.
  6. Cool and Chill: Allow to cool at room temperature for 30 minutes, then refrigerate for at least 4 hours.
